*Maybe some blue eyed sould could fit in: "I Got A Thing ABout You Baby", "Anyday Now" "Long Black Limousine", leaving out some others?
Don't know if "Polk Salad Annie" could qualify, maybe not, now "Burning Love" was originally a R&B single by Arthur Alexander, but Elvis record is more R&R that R&B, but maybe also could be a choice.
"That's All Right", and "Baby Le'ts Play House", where originally R&R songs, but in Elvis hands they became Rockabilly by definition, so I don't think they qualify R&B. "Trying To Get To YOu" "Guitar Man" & "After Loving You" are more country than blues than blues or R&B, but they pass as them anyhow, as they are way blues and R&B infected performances anyway, so could be possible choices.
Many 50's and early 60's Presley charted high in the top ten R&B charts, stuff like Don't, Jailhouse Rock, All Shook Up, Wear My Ring, Stuck on You, Are You Lonesome Tonight. Can't say if that made of them candidates for an Elvis R&B collection.
